Build-A-Bear Q4 FY2025 pre-tax income falls 22% to USD 21.55 million as revenue rises 37% to USD 15.1 million in commercial and international franchising segments

Build-A-Bear reported Q4 FY2025 total revenues of USD 154.5 million, up 3%, and pre-tax income of USD 21.5 million, down 22% due to an approximately USD 6 million tariff and related cost impact. Q4 FY2025 diluted EPS was USD 1.26, down 22%, while consolidated e-commerce demand fell 14% and commercial and international franchising segment revenues rose 38% to USD 15.1 million. For FY2025, total revenues were USD 529.8 million, up 7%, and diluted EPS rose 5% to USD 3.99. FY2025 pre-tax income was USD 67.2 million, with an approximately USD 11 million tariff and related cost impact, and the company returned USD 39 million to shareholders through share repurchases and quarterly dividends. Build-A-Bear raised its quarterly dividend 5% to USD 0.23 per share and forecast FY2026 total revenue growth in the mid-single digits, with pre-tax income ranging from a mid-single-digit decline to low single-digit growth inclusive of approximately USD 16 million of tariff and related costs.
